Average full-time tuition and fees are listed in the table below.
| In State | Out of State | |
|---|---|---|
| Tuition | $5,800 | $11,600 |
| Fees | $530 | $530 |

This dietetics & nutrition services program at Nassau Community College includes the following concentrations:
| Concentration | Annual Graduates |
|---|---|
| Dietitian Assistant | 2 |
Nassau Community College granted 2 completions in dietitian assistant recently — 100% to women and 0% to men. The largest share of these graduates were Black or African American (100%).
